Message: From GoLocalProv by GoLocalProv Health Team: The number of people with Alzheimer’s disease is expected to triple in the next 40 years, according to a new study published in the February 6, 2013, online issue of Neurology®, the medical journal of the American Academy of Neurology. And in Rhode Island, which has the largest percentage of its population that's age 85 or older in the country, this projection has major implications. http://www.golocalprov.comhttp://beta.golocalprov.com/alzheimers-patients-may-triple-by-2050-ri-experts-react
